Met Ball 2013: the red carpet

beyoncé-met-ball-2013

Last night a plenty of stars hit the red carpet at the Metropolitan Museum of New York for one of the biggest night of the fashion calendar, the Met Ball.

This year the theme was punk to celebrate the opening of the Costume Institute’s exhibition “Punk: Chaos to Couture”. Many attendees took the dress code pretty seriously adding an edgy touch to their outfits. Among them were Sarah Jessica Parker with a mohican headdress by Philip Treacy and  Madonna in a Givenchy tartan jacket styled with thigh high stockings and a black wig. But not all the celebrities went punk so, Gwyneth Paltrow stood out with a classic Valentino gown in bold pink, meanwhile Jennifer Lawrence was ladylike in Christian Dior.

Alexa Chung’s best moments

cover-alexa-chung

There are few people in the world who can be effortlessly chic and Alexa Chung is one of them. With her distinctive look made of girlish vibes combined with a whimsical hipster twist, she has easily caught the eye of the fashion world becoming a style icon. Her trademarks? Alexa loves to wear minis, peter pan collars, ladylike frocks and ballet flats while her passion for the schoolboy satchels inspired a popular it bag named in her honor. But she is not only known for her quirky outfits even her beauty details are trendsetting, such as the bright red lips, the winged eyeliner and the perfectly tousled hair.

Awarded three times as British Style Icon, Alexa is now working on her debut book in which she will unveil her fashion world. It will be released in September but for now get some ideas from our photo gallery with Alexa’s best dressed moments!

Playful illustrations by Sunny Gu

Sunny-Gu-Illustrations

Sunny Gu is a L.A. based illustrator and a gallery artist. The idea behind her work is simple as charming: to capture and preserve beauty. Indeed, she started to observe and discover beauties in everything around her during the childhood when she decided to recreate them through art.

Inspired by runway looks and fashion editorials, her illustrations are always full of vibrant colors, rich details and delightful feelings.

Fashion illustrator: Garance Doré

01-Garance-Dore

Writer, illustrator and street style photographer, Garance Doré is a fashion star and together with her fiancé Scott Schuman, aka The Sartorialist, she dominates the Web scene.

Inspired by a strong passion for art, in 2006 she started publishing her illustrations in 2006 and after a short time she raised the fashion’s A-list. The secret behind her success? A classic style combined with a splash of color and obviously a French chic touch.
